ИСКУССТВЕННЫЙ ИНТЕЛЛЕКТ И РАЗРАБОТКА ИГРЫ

Что приходит вам на ум, когда вы слышите искусственный интеллект? Вероятно, это система, имитирующая разумных существ? Вы правы, если это ваши мысли! Искусственный интеллект (ИИ) — это разум, демонстрируемый машинами, в отличие от естественного интеллекта, демонстрируемого людьми.

Искусственный интеллект широко используется для обозначения проекта, направленного на создание систем с человеческими когнитивными способностями, такими как способность рассуждать, различать смысл, обобщать и учиться на прошлых событиях и последовательном опыте (учиться по ходу дела, т. е. машинное обучение). ). С годами ИИ приобрел актуальность в отраслях и имеет множество приложений, а также может выполнять задачи, которые обычно требуют человеческого интеллекта, такие как распознавание речи, принятие решений и визуальное восприятие. Искусственный интеллект (ИИ) на рабочем месте коренным образом меняет методы работы предприятий. ИИ интегрируется в деятельность компании с целью экономии денег, повышения эффективности, предоставления информации и открытия новых рынков.

Так что не сомневайтесь! ИИ проникает в разные сектора и меняет многое! Интерес людей, интересующихся ИИ, ориентирован на карьерные пути, такие как инженер машинного обучения, инженер данных, инженер ИИ и аналитик данных.

Разработка игр относится к процессу проектирования, разработки и выпуска игры. Это может включать в себя создание концепции, дизайн, строительство, тестирование и распространение. Разработчик игр может работать программистом, звуковым дизайнером, художником или дизайнером, а также многими другими должностями в бизнесе.

Над разработкой игр может работать огромная студия разработки игр или один человек. Он может быть таким большим или маленьким, как вы выберете. Вы можете назвать это «игрой», если она позволяет игроку взаимодействовать с контентом и изменять аспекты игры.

Вам не нужно знать, как кодировать, чтобы участвовать в процессе разработки игры. Художники могут создавать и проектировать предметы, тогда как разработчик может программировать полосу здоровья. Можно привлечь тестировщика, чтобы убедиться, что игра работает, как задумано.

При создании игры очень важно учитывать технические аспекты игры, преимущества, интерес и энтузиазм игроков, а также дизайн уровней. Поскольку искусственный интеллект имеет тенденцию брать на себя дела многих технологических отраслей, ИГРОВАЯ ИНДУСТРИЯ не остается в стороне. В последнее время большинство разработчиков игр внедрили ИИ для улучшения пользовательского (игрокового) опыта. ИИ становится распространенным инструментом в разработке игр. Несмотря на то, что искусственный интеллект в видеоиграх все еще находится в зачаточном состоянии, разработчики игр начали замечать привлекательные преимущества искусственного интеллекта в отрасли.

Многие разработчики игр предпочитают использовать Game Development Engine для создания своих игр. Игровые движки могут упростить процесс разработки игр и позволить разработчикам повторно использовать множество функций. Он также обрабатывает рендеринг 2D- и 3D-графики, физику, обнаружение столкновений, звук, сценарии и многое другое.

Игровые движки с искусственным интеллектом, такие как Amazon Lumberyard, CryEngine 3, Panda 3D, Unity 3D и Unreal Engine, используют C++ и Python, чтобы помочь разработчикам игр наслаждаться гибкостью создания игр, экзотической интерактивной средой и лучшим пользовательским интерфейсом в отличие от других обычных игровых движков без встроенная система ИИ. Другими словами, ИИ использовался для улучшения игровых моделей, чтобы создавать более сложные и интересные игры.

Важность ИИ в разработке игр важнее простых предположений или восприятия. Разработчики игр пытаются предоставить геймерам полезные интерактивные возможности. В результате ИИ быстро превращается в непревзойденный инструмент, помогающий разработчикам игр координировать постоянно усложняющуюся игровую динамику. Исследования показали, что растущая популярность ИИ в играх имеет огромные финансовые последствия для бизнеса. Ожидается, что к 2026 году игровая индустрия станет одним из самых прибыльных секторов с рыночной стоимостью около 314 миллиардов долларов. В результате финансирование разработки игр на основе ИИ постоянно увеличивается во всем мире. В этой области появляется множество новых предприятий. Например, в январе 2021 года Latitude, фирма, создающая игры на основе повествований о бесконечности, созданных искусственным интеллектом, привлекла венчурное финансирование в размере 3,3 миллиона долларов США.

ИНСТРУМЕНТЫ ИИ В РАЗРАБОТКЕ ИГРЫ

Инструменты искусственного интеллекта, такие как деревья решений (DT), глубокие нейронные сети, обучение с подкреплением и генетические алгоритмы, используют классификацию и регрессию, человеческие структуры, которые могут изучать многочисленные атрибуты из обучающих данных с учетом большого набора данных, естественный отбор , в котором выбираются наиболее подходящие кандидаты для создания потомков, а метод проб и ошибок — отличный способ научиться оптимизировать разработку игр в целом.

ИИ можно использовать для улучшения изображения, автоматизированной разработки уровней, сценариев и повествования, уравновешивания игровой сложности и придания интеллекта неигровым персонажам, среди прочего (NPC).

Однако приложения искусственного интеллекта (ИИ) в играх имеют некоторые недостатки. Например, сложно разработать реалистичных противников NPC (неигровых персонажей), которые могут вызвать интересную энергию у каждого человека. Противники NPC на основе ИИ обычно предназначены для максимально эффективной реакции на действия игрока. Такие элементы непобедимы, но они также предсказуемы и быстро теряют свою привлекательность.

Если вы являетесь экспертом по ИИ и пытаетесь исследовать эту область Применение ИИ в разработке игр, ознакомьтесь с этим проектом на https://indatalabs.com/industry/ai-game-solutions.

Автор Джасия Эбубечи

Инженер по машинному обучению и член группы управления в Six Path Studios